Five people killed in held Kashmir

SRINAGAR: Suspected militants killed five people, including two soldiers, on Wednesday in held Kashmir, police said.
The attackers, wearing camouflage dress, opened fire on an army post in the outskirts of Jammu.
“The attack killed five people and injured several others,” a police spokesman said.
“The Indian army, backed by police and paramilitary forces, has launched a major operation to eliminate these militants,” he said.
